What is being bought
NHS Arden & Greater East Midlands Commissioning Support Unit (AGCSU), on behalf of NHS
England (North Midlands) (i.e. the Commissioner) is carrying out an expressions of interest exercise for the Provision of Integrated Healthcare Services at HMP North Sea Camp, HMP Lincoln and Morton Hall Immigration Removal Centre
In addition to informing the market of the possible forthcoming opportunity, the commissioner would like to ascertain the views of the provider market on the preferred lotting strategy for any future procurement.

- Lot 1 · #1Individual lot title not publishedplannedPublished valueNot publishedHMP North Sea Camp is situated in Boston in Lincolnshire, an open prison which currently houses approximately 420 patients. HMP YOI Lincoln is situated in Lincoln and is a category B prison and currently has 738 patients. Morton Hall Immigration Removal Centre (IRC) is situated in Swinderby, Lincolnshire and will close in July 2021 in preparation for becoming a Category C men’s prison for Foreign Nationals with approximately 413 patients opening in December 2021. A Short Term Holding Facility (STHF), Swinderby Unity will open in August 2021 which is located close to the Morton Hall prison, this facility will be a 35 mixed sex short term holding facility The Commissioners are considering the following options for their lotting strategy:- Option 1) Lot 1: HMP North Sea Camp, HMP Lincoln, Morton Hall and the Swinderby Unit. Option 2) Lot 1: HMP North Sea Camp Lot 2: HMP Lincoln Lot 3: Morton Hall Lot 4: Swinderby Unit Option 3) Lot 1: HMP North Sea Camp and HMP Lincoln Lot 2: Morton Hall and the Swinderby Unit. Option 4) Lot 1: HMP North Sea Camp, HMP Lincoln and Morton Hall Lot 2: Swinderby Unit Commissioners would be interested in hearing the markets views on these or any other possible lotting options. Due to forthcoming national changes, NHS England are currently unable to give details on the contract length. The aim of the market engagement exercise is to inform potential providers on the opportunity and to assist the commissioner in deciding on the most appropriate strategy for the future procurement.
